| 118386356 | Just a note about parking lots: general practice is to draw bounds around the entire lot, including the highway into the lot, rather than marking clumps of spots as separate lots. |

| 109433141 | Remember to be extra careful when splicing ways that are members of routes, as the order of the route members can get jumbled. The iD editor doesn't provide tools for this; JOSM is the way to go in these cases. |
